Ahmadpur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Ahmadpur Village has a population of 976 (976) with 509 (509) males and 467 (467) females.The sex ratio in Ahmadpur is 918,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Ahmadpur Village is 136 (136) which is 13.93% of Ahmadpur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Ahmadpur Village is 1000 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Ahmadpur village is listed as part of the Varanasi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Varanasi District in the state of UTTAR PRADESH in INDIA.
The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Ahmadpur Literacy Rate
Ahmadpur Village has a literacy rate of 77.5%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Ahmadpur Village is 89.12 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Ahmadpur Village is 64.66 higher than national average of 64.63%.

Ahmadpur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Ahmadpur Village is 42 (42) with 22 (22) males and 20 (20) females, which is 4.3% of Ahmadpur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 910 females for every 1000 males.
Ahmadpur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es Population in Ahmadpur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Ahmadpur Village.

Ahmadpur Area & Households
The Total Number of households in Ahmadpur Village are 137 (137).
Ahmadpur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Ahmadpur Village, there are about 260 (260) workers, making up nearly 26.64% of the Ahmadpur Village total population. Out of these, around 238 (238) are male workers, and about 22 (22) are female workers.
